Output 38c59a394715242eb6c22eb6d2e8bc09154058acfe418d72330669f25eec8c1d:0

value
12404013
script pubkey
OP_0 OP_PUSHBYTES_20 d2aab96d6a980bc760b499bb0a981debaa704724
address
bc1q624tjmt2nq9uwc95nxas4xqaaw48q3eys8j240
transaction
38c59a394715242eb6c22eb6d2e8bc09154058acfe418d72330669f25eec8c1d
spent
true